Tixel
PRE-TREATMENT INSTRUCTIONS
Contraindications
-Pregnancy
-Breastfeeding
-Topical antibiotic/steroid use within the last 7 days
-Retinol, Retin-A, AHA/BHA, Enzymes, Vitamin C, or any active ingredient use within the last 7 days
-Accutane use within the last 6 months
-Active cold sore or fever blister
-Vaccines or flu shots within the last 2 weeks
-Prolonged sun exposure or sun burns within the last 7 days
-Skin infection/disease
-Blood thinner use within the last 7 days

POST-TREATMENT INSTRUCTIONS
• Immediately after your treatment, swelling, “pinkness” and sunburn sensation is normal and can last from several hours to up to 1-2 days. Your skin may feel dry, tight, sensitive to touch.
• Do not apply any topicals other than exosomes, as directed, for 6 hours after your treatment.
• Sleep on your back for the first night.
• You may use ice and cold air for discomfort during this period. You can also take over the counter Ibuprofen for discomfort.
• Avoid strenuous activity, sun exposure, sweating, sauna, jacuzzi, hot showers for up to 3 days or longer if your skin still feels sensitive.
• If you are prone to fever blisters, please make sure to let us know so we can call in an antiviral for you to take during your treatment.
• You can wear makeup the day following your treatment.
​
Day 2-5: Cleanse with a gentle cleanser, apply REPAIR in AM, followed by sunscreen. Bronze micro spots (stamp marks) can be seen. Do not pick, scratch or scrub. Can cover with makeup. Repeat cleansing at night and apply REPAIR again.
Day 6-10: Pigment will start to soften, flake and fade. You may start all of your regular products after using exosomes REPAIR for 5 days.
